What is T-Market?
T-Market is an online marketplace designed specifically for the diaspora. It allows Haitians living abroad (Canada, the USA, etc.) to directly purchase essential goods (solar kits, refrigerators, motorcycles, furniture, etc.) for their families in Haiti.
- No money transfers.
- No middlemen.
- Just products delivered directly, with supporting documentation.
